分数是什么类型数据库
-
分数是一种类型的数据库,它主要用于存储和管理学生的考试成绩和评分信息。以下是关于分数数据库的一些重要特点和功能:
-
数据结构:分数数据库通常采用表格的结构来存储数据,每个表格代表一个实体(如学生、课程、考试等),每列代表一个属性(如学号、课程名称、分数等)。
-
数据录入:分数数据库提供了数据录入的功能,可以通过手动输入或导入文件的方式将学生的考试成绩录入数据库中。录入数据时,可以同时记录学生的基本信息,如姓名、学号等。
-
数据查询:分数数据库支持各种查询操作,可以根据学生的学号、课程名称、时间等条件进行查询,以获取特定学生或特定课程的成绩。查询结果可以按照分数的升序或降序排列,方便进行比较和分析。
-
数据分析:分数数据库可以进行各种数据分析和统计操作,如计算某门课程的平均分、最高分、最低分,或者计算某个学生的总分、平均分等。这些分析结果可以帮助教师和学校了解学生的学习情况,进行评估和改进教学质量。
-
数据安全:分数数据库需要保证数据的安全性和可靠性。通常会采用权限管理机制,设置不同用户的权限级别,以控制对数据库的访问和操作。同时,还会进行数据备份和恢复操作,以防止数据丢失或损坏。
总之,分数数据库是一种用于存储和管理学生考试成绩和评分信息的专用数据库,它可以帮助学校和教师有效地管理和分析学生成绩,提高教学质量和学生的学习成果。
1年前 -
-
分数是一种类型的数据库,它主要用于存储和管理学生的成绩信息。在分数数据库中,通常包含学生的个人信息、课程信息以及具体的成绩数据。
分数数据库的结构可以根据实际需求进行设计,但一般会包括以下几个主要的表:
-
学生表:该表用于存储学生的个人信息,如学生ID、姓名、性别、年龄等。每个学生会有唯一的学生ID,作为主键用于标识学生的身份。
-
课程表:该表用于存储课程的信息,如课程ID、课程名称、学分等。每个课程也会有唯一的课程ID作为主键。
-
成绩表:该表用于存储学生的具体成绩信息,包括学生ID、课程ID以及对应的成绩。成绩表的主键可以是学生ID和课程ID的组合,用于唯一标识一条成绩记录。
除了上述基本表之外,还可以根据实际需求设计其他辅助表,如教师表(用于存储教师的信息)、学院表(用于存储学院的信息)等。
在分数数据库中,可以通过SQL语句进行各种查询操作,如按照学生ID查询学生的成绩、按照课程ID查询某门课程的所有学生成绩等。同时,还可以对成绩进行统计和分析,如计算学生的平均成绩、最高成绩、最低成绩等。
分数数据库的应用范围非常广泛,不仅可以在学校、教育机构中使用,还可以应用于培训机构、在线教育平台等。通过分数数据库的管理,可以方便地记录和管理学生成绩,为教学管理提供有效的支持和依据。
1年前 -
-
分数是一种类型数据库,也被称为键值数据库或NoSQL数据库。它与传统的关系型数据库相比,具有更简单的数据模型和更高的可扩展性。
分数数据库的基本概念是键值对的存储方式。每个数据项都由一个唯一的键和对应的值组成。键是用来标识数据项的唯一标识符,而值可以是任意类型的数据,如字符串、数字、列表、哈希表等。
分数数据库通常具有以下特点:
-
高性能:分数数据库采用内存存储和索引技术,可以快速读取和写入大量数据。它们通常具有低延迟和高吞吐量的特点,适用于需要高并发处理和实时查询的应用场景。
-
可扩展性:分数数据库可以通过横向扩展来处理大规模数据。它们支持分布式架构,可以将数据存储在多台服务器上,提高系统的容量和性能。
-
灵活的数据模型:分数数据库不需要事先定义数据模式,可以根据实际需要动态添加、修改和删除数据项。这使得分数数据库特别适合处理半结构化和不规则数据。
-
高可用性:分数数据库通常支持数据的复制和备份功能,以提供高可用性和数据冗余。当一个节点发生故障时,系统可以自动切换到备用节点,保证数据的持久性和可靠性。
常见的分数数据库包括Redis、Memcached、Cassandra、Riak等。它们各有优势和特点,可以根据具体的应用需求选择合适的数据库。
1年前 -